Starting and finishing in the village of Grassington in the Yorkshire Dales, this walk boasts a vast array of gems ready to discover. The rolling hills and farmer’s fields offer a stunning patchwork masterpiece, whilst the wonderful woodlands and rocky outcrops of Upper Wharfedale are waiting to be explored.

Grassington is a small market town in Upper Wharfedale in the Yorkshire Dales. There are many independent shops, pubs and cafes, making it the perfect spot for a walk. Did you know it is also the film set for ‘Darrowby’ in the TV Series ‘All Creatures Great and Small’?.

The route starts from the National Park Visitor Centre where there is parking and toilets. From here, make your way towards the market town’s square and high street. The road will fork off to the left, following the beautiful dry-stone walls of Cove Lane past the many stone field barns (also called Cowhouses). There are around 6200 of these in the Yorkshire Dales and they have been known to support some special species like Bats, Barn Owls and Swallows.

Keep following the path towards the woods to a style. This will take you to the foot of Grass Wood Nature Reserve, a beautiful Ash woodland with forest glades and exposed rock. It’s a must-see, especially in springtime when the forest floor is full of colour and life. It’s a moderately challenging hill through the woodland but there are plenty of places to pause and enjoy your surroundings (or catch your breath!).

From here, you will turn right towards Bastow Wood. Once you’ve navigated a few styles, you will turn right again along the dry-stone wall back towards Grassington. It’s a beautiful view and the perfect spot to enjoy a coffee from a flask!
Take the main bridlepath back towards Grassington and treat yourself in one of Grassington’s many pubs or cafes.
